How to choose a crypto exchange in Canada?
In Canada, the question of "How to choose a crypto exchange?" is a crucial one for those interested in investing in digital currencies. Firstly, consider the exchange's reputation and track record. Look for platforms that have been operating for some time and have a good standing in the industry. Secondly, check for security measures like encryption, cold storage, and two-factor authentication. Your funds should be protected at all times. Additionally, evaluate the exchange's range of cryptocurrencies and trading pairs. Does it offer the coins you're interested in? Are the trading fees competitive? Lastly, consider customer support and ease of use. A good exchange should provide responsive customer service and a user-friendly interface. Remember, choosing the right crypto exchange is a key step in your crypto journey.
